What was the surprise, or “break,” that started it all?
As Survivor Day came to a close and the excitement of the rope burn settled, a new sound drifted across camp. In the distance came the gallop of horses, the twang of a banjo, and the unmistakable beep, beep of an antique car horn.
Then, over the hill and onto Mitchell Field, came a parade unlike any other.
Campers rushed to join the spectacle as a hayride wound its way into camp and down a secret trail behind Girls’ Loop. Waiting there was an incredible surprise: the ropes course had been transformed into a full-fledged rock ‘n’ roll stage.
The excitement only grew from there. Hal Schwartz soared across the sky on the zip line as a Pine Forest Color Days anthem filled the air. Pyrotechnics exploded, the crowd erupted, and the spirit of competition officially came to life.
Color Days lasts for 3 full days of competition with games, skits and songs all culminating in “The Sing.” To follow every score, game, and exciting moment, we have a special page designed just for PFC’s Color Days. Keep checking it for the latest news!
